OK, mystery solved (partially)

There were 8 cards in the set, numbered PSD-01 to 08 and they say "Limited Edition"

The backs say "Celebrating Wacky Packages & Garbage Pail Kids and the Lives of Jay Lynch and Frank Reighter"

They also say Philly Non Sports Card Show, Allentown, PA, April 22, 2017
